## Action Item SA-7: Baseline file drift

The Thornvale scanner's baseline file silently suppressed a new injection finding because baseline entries never expire. Remediation: add expiry and size limits to the baseline, fail CI when suppressed findings exceed the cap, and require reviewer sign-off on baseline updates. For audit purposes, the enforced thresholds are listed here.

constants for fajop-tahaf:
RATE_LIMITS = {
    "holael": 2,
    "oliael": 10,
    "druael": 10,
    "wenwyn": 10,
}

Heads up, plugin folks: the Slatecheck static-analysis baseline file is now generated at release time, not committed by hand. If your plugin flags new findings, diff against the shipped baseline first. Each baseline embeds the exact pipeline run that produced it, so provenance questions are easy — just quote the token below.

pipeline stamp: htk9_6ce9d33c5

## Runbook: Quillgate CSV Import Wizard

The import wizard accepts customer-supplied CSVs, validates headers, and stages rows before commit. All parsing runs in a sandboxed worker with upload size and row-count caps enforced server-side. Rejected rows are logged without payload contents. For your review, the enforcement limits and sandbox settings currently active in production are as follows.

service settings:
PRAWYN_PIN=9848
PRAWYN_METRICS_HOST=metrics.prawyn.lumicworks.corp
PRAWYN_LOG_LEVEL=warn
PRAWYN_TENANT=pelius

**Mgmt Meeting Minutes — Retiring the Brightline Range**

Quick recap for sales leads at Fenholt Supplies: we agreed to retire the Brightline fixture range by year-end. Remaining stock moves to clearance pricing next month, and accounts on standing orders get migrated to the Lumetta range. Trade-in incentives were approved in principle. The confidential note on next steps sits just below.

board note of bajof-bajeg: The pricing group signed off on a budget of $13.4 million for Project Sildor. The renewal with Lamixek Holdings closes at $48.9 million a year, 49 percent above the last contract.